Output 8663d1909a4c829f8612633f5fd85f91971950d525c7dfb268afd421a2c8305e:1

value
2941732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e99b4213b174b182c33a043e14e884d9cbb64d61 OP_EQUAL
address
3NzDMmD9wt8vJhz2uLCZSL9nyqobkpqVbK
transaction
8663d1909a4c829f8612633f5fd85f91971950d525c7dfb268afd421a2c8305e
spent
true